What is China's signature drink?

China's signature drink is tea. This conventional beverage has a wealthy historical past and is deeply ingrained in Chinese culture. Various types of tea are enjoyed throughout the nation, each with its distinctive flavor and well being advantages.


Types of Chinese Tea

Green Tea: Known for its contemporary and grassy flavor, in style varieties embrace Longjing and 부산유흥 Biluochun.
Black Tea: Often enjoyed for its wealthy and strong taste, with well-known varieties like Keemun and Yunnan.
Oolong Tea: A partially fermented tea that lies between green and black tea, such as Tieguanyin and Da Hong Pao.
Pu-erh Tea: A fermented tea with a singular earthy flavor that improves with age.
White Tea: Delicate and refined, well-known varieties include Silver Needle and White Peony.



Tea ceremonies are an essential a half of social gatherings, emphasizing hospitality and respect for tradition.


Significance of Tea in Chinese Culture

Symbol of hospitality and respect.
Utilized in conventional medication for 광주유흥 its health benefits.
Integral to cultural rituals and celebrations.



Overall, tea is more than only a drink in China; it's a cultural symbol that represents historical past, heritage, and the artwork of living.
